Homebridge Sony ADCP Projector

npm Homebridge Verified

Control your Sony projector over IP using the ADCP protocol. This plugin exposes the projector to Apple HomeKit as a Television accessory, complete with power control, input selection, and the native Remote UI in the Home app.


Features

Core

  • Power On / Off from the Home app.
  • Input Source Selection (HDMI1, HDMI2, etc.).
  • HomeKit Television UI with remote control support.
  • Optional ADCP Authentication.
  • Automatic Serial Number Retrieval.

Optional Controls (model-dependent)

  • Volume and mute.
  • Brightness, contrast, picture mode.
  • Aspect ratio, screen position, screen size.
  • Freeze and split screen.

Other

  • Persistent TCP/IP connection.
  • Error & warning status monitoring.
  • Detailed logging for troubleshooting.

Requirements

  • Node.js >= 18.20.0
  • Homebridge >= 1.6.0
  • A Sony projector with ADCP enabled (Settings > Network Settings > ADCP)
  • The projector’s IP address (reserve it via DHCP for stability)
  • Default ADCP port: 53595

Installation

sudo npm install -g homebridge
sudo npm install -g homebridge-sony-adcp-projector

Configuration

Use the Homebridge UI to configure the plugin via the graphical settings editor. The most important fields:

| Field | Type | Default | Description | | ---------- | ------- | -------------- | ---------------------------------------------- | | ip | string | — | Projector IP address (required). | | adcpPort | integer | 53595 | TCP port for ADCP. | | useAuth | boolean | false | Whether ADCP authentication is required. | | password | string | — | Password for ADCP authentication (if enabled). | | timeout | integer | 5 | Timeout in seconds for commands. | | inputs | array | HDMI 1, HDMI 2 | Inputs to appear in HomeKit. |

Example JSON config:

{
  "accessories": [
    {
      "accessory": "SonyProjector",
      "name": "Sony Projector",
      "ip": "192.168.1.101",
      "adcpPort": 53595,
      "useAuth": false,
      "timeout": 5,
      "inputs": [
        { "id": 1, "name": "Apple TV", "adcp": "hdmi1" },
        { "id": 2, "name": "PS5", "adcp": "hdmi2" }
      ]
    }
  ]
}

Usage

Once added to HomeKit:

  • Single tap the TV tile to toggle power.
  • Long press to open remote controls, input selector, and settings.
  • Select inputs from the list defined in your config.

Troubleshooting

  • No response / offline → Verify ADCP is enabled and the IP/port are correct.
  • Authentication errors → Ensure projector’s ADCP settings match the plugin config.
  • Slow commands → Increase timeout in plugin settings.

Development

Clone the repo and link it to a local Homebridge instance:

git clone https://github.com/steven-ward/Homebridge-Sony-ADCP-Projector-Plugin.git
cd Homebridge-Sony-ADCP-Projector-Plugin
npm install
npm link
homebridge -D -P .
